Samsung launched two other 4G enabled smartphones.

Facing growing competition from brands like Micromax and Xiaomi, Samsung on Monday launched the Galaxy J1 4G — to be priced at Rs 9,900 in India — as the Korean electronics giant looks to protect its turf in one of the world’s fastest growing smartphone markets.

It launched two other 4G enabled smartphones — Galaxy Grand Prime 4G and the Galaxy Core Prime 4G. Samsung also unveiled its slimmest Galaxy handset — the Galaxy A7, priced at Rs 30,499.

Samsung's ChatOn messagingservice is shutting down next year.

Looks like Samsung's ChatOn messaging service is shutting down next year.
It's worth pointing out that the service faced stiff competition from the likes of WhatsApp, Line and WeChat which claim to have a considerably bigger active user base.WhatsApp claimed to have 600 million active users in August and is reportedly the biggest among all services.

Apple Watch will be launched globally in early 2015 and there is no further update.

As per estimates, the price of the Apple Watch will be about Rs 28,000-35,000, which will be more than the cost of wearable products sold by rivals Samsung and Sony.

The device will be compatible with the iPhone 5, 5c, 5s, 6 and 6 Plus, which run the latest operating system.
